anim built names are updated (LV_ prefix added)
This commit is contained in:
@@ -979,7 +979,7 @@ void lv_obj_anim(lv_obj_t * obj_dp, lv_anim_builtin_t type, uint16_t time, uint1
|
|||||||
bool out = (type & ANIM_DIR_MASK) == ANIM_IN ? false : true;
|
bool out = (type & ANIM_DIR_MASK) == ANIM_IN ? false : true;
|
||||||
type = type & (~ANIM_DIR_MASK);
|
type = type & (~ANIM_DIR_MASK);
|
||||||
|
|
||||||
if(type == ANIM_NONE) return;
|
if(type == LV_ANIM_NONE) return;
|
||||||
|
|
||||||
anim_t a;
|
anim_t a;
|
||||||
a.p = obj_dp;
|
a.p = obj_dp;
|
||||||
@@ -989,43 +989,43 @@ void lv_obj_anim(lv_obj_t * obj_dp, lv_anim_builtin_t type, uint16_t time, uint1
|
|||||||
|
|
||||||
/*Init to ANIM_IN*/
|
/*Init to ANIM_IN*/
|
||||||
switch(type) {
|
switch(type) {
|
||||||
case ANIM_FLOAT_LEFT:
|
case LV_ANIM_FLOAT_LEFT:
|
||||||
a.fp = (void(*)(void *, int32_t))lv_obj_set_x;
|
a.fp = (void(*)(void *, int32_t))lv_obj_set_x;
|
||||||
a.start = -lv_obj_get_width(obj_dp);
|
a.start = -lv_obj_get_width(obj_dp);
|
||||||
a.end = lv_obj_get_x(obj_dp);
|
a.end = lv_obj_get_x(obj_dp);
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_FLOAT_RIGHT:
|
case LV_ANIM_FLOAT_RIGHT:
|
||||||
a.fp = (void(*)(void *, int32_t))lv_obj_set_x;
|
a.fp = (void(*)(void *, int32_t))lv_obj_set_x;
|
||||||
a.start = lv_obj_get_width(par_dp);
|
a.start = lv_obj_get_width(par_dp);
|
||||||
a.end = lv_obj_get_x(obj_dp);
|
a.end = lv_obj_get_x(obj_dp);
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_FLOAT_TOP:
|
case LV_ANIM_FLOAT_TOP:
|
||||||
a.fp = (void(*)(void * , int32_t))lv_obj_set_y;
|
a.fp = (void(*)(void * , int32_t))lv_obj_set_y;
|
||||||
a.start = -lv_obj_get_height(obj_dp);
|
a.start = -lv_obj_get_height(obj_dp);
|
||||||
a.end = lv_obj_get_y(obj_dp);
|
a.end = lv_obj_get_y(obj_dp);
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_FLOAT_BOTTOM:
|
case LV_ANIM_FLOAT_BOTTOM:
|
||||||
a.fp = (void(*)(void * , int32_t))lv_obj_set_y;
|
a.fp = (void(*)(void * , int32_t))lv_obj_set_y;
|
||||||
a.start = lv_obj_get_height(par_dp);
|
a.start = lv_obj_get_height(par_dp);
|
||||||
a.end = lv_obj_get_y(obj_dp);
|
a.end = lv_obj_get_y(obj_dp);
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_FADE:
|
case LV_ANIM_FADE:
|
||||||
a.fp = (void(*)(void * , int32_t))lv_obj_set_opar;
|
a.fp = (void(*)(void * , int32_t))lv_obj_set_opar;
|
||||||
a.start = OPA_TRANSP;
|
a.start = OPA_TRANSP;
|
||||||
a.end = OPA_COVER;
|
a.end = OPA_COVER;
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_GROW_H:
|
case LV_ANIM_GROW_H:
|
||||||
a.fp = (void(*)(void * , int32_t))lv_obj_set_width;
|
a.fp = (void(*)(void * , int32_t))lv_obj_set_width;
|
||||||
a.start = 0;
|
a.start = 0;
|
||||||
a.end = lv_obj_get_width(obj_dp);
|
a.end = lv_obj_get_width(obj_dp);
|
||||||
a.path_p = anim_path_lin;
|
a.path_p = anim_path_lin;
|
||||||
break;
|
break;
|
||||||
case ANIM_GROW_V:
|
case LV_ANIM_GROW_V:
|
||||||
a.fp = (void(*)(void * , int32_t))lv_obj_set_height;
|
a.fp = (void(*)(void * , int32_t))lv_obj_set_height;
|
||||||
a.start = 0;
|
a.start = 0;
|
||||||
a.end = lv_obj_get_height(obj_dp);
|
a.end = lv_obj_get_height(obj_dp);
|
||||||
|
|||||||
@@ -150,14 +150,14 @@ typedef enum
|
|||||||
|
|
||||||
typedef enum
|
typedef enum
|
||||||
{
|
{
|
||||||
ANIM_NONE = 0,
|
LV_ANIM_NONE = 0,
|
||||||
ANIM_FADE,
|
LV_ANIM_FADE,
|
||||||
ANIM_FLOAT_TOP,
|
LV_ANIM_FLOAT_TOP,
|
||||||
ANIM_FLOAT_LEFT,
|
LV_ANIM_FLOAT_LEFT,
|
||||||
ANIM_FLOAT_BOTTOM,
|
LV_ANIM_FLOAT_BOTTOM,
|
||||||
ANIM_FLOAT_RIGHT,
|
LV_ANIM_FLOAT_RIGHT,
|
||||||
ANIM_GROW_H,
|
LV_ANIM_GROW_H,
|
||||||
ANIM_GROW_V,
|
LV_ANIM_GROW_V,
|
||||||
}lv_anim_builtin_t;
|
}lv_anim_builtin_t;
|
||||||
|
|
||||||
/**********************
|
/**********************
|
||||||
|
|||||||
Reference in New Issue
Block a user